Apple Working to Resolve Silent Alarm Issue for Some iPhone Users

There have been reports on social media from iPhone users in recent weeks, encountering a peculiar issue where the alarm clock does not sound loudly. The latest news from Apple’s representative confirmed with The Wall Street Journal that they are aware of this issue and are currently working on a solution.

Apple stated that the problem lies in the alarm clock setting on some iPhones, where in some cases, it fails to sound when it’s time to wake up. This has led to many users reporting issues such as being late, missing appointments, and other related consequences.

However, before Apple addresses this issue, some users speculate that the alarm clock problem may be related to a feature called Attention Aware, which reduces the volume of alerts if the user is looking at the device. iPhones detect this through the TrueDepth front camera. If anyone encounters the mentioned problem, a temporary solution may be found by going to Settings > Face ID & Passcode and turning off Attention Aware.
